expo+firebase身份验证(身份工具包)api密钥限制

hrirmatl  于 2021-09-29  发布在  Java
关注(0)|答案(0)|浏览(221)

简而言之:安卓应用程序,通过expo完成,使用firebase身份验证(identity toolkit)api密钥是否可以限制使用安卓应用程序?
我有一个使用firebase服务的android应用程序。我在firebase项目中添加了android应用程序,并试图限制android应用程序自动生成的密钥(在谷歌控制台中),但没有成功。
-我用过https://docs.expo.io/guides/using-firebase/ 用于firebase sdk安装。
-下载google-service.json,将其添加到项目根目录中(与app.json处于同一级别),并在app.json“expo.android.googleservicesfile”中对其进行定义:“/google services.json”。
-并在谷歌控制台上为我的firebase项目的android应用程序自动生成api密钥:
--我已经定义了“android应用程序”应用程序限制,
--从app.json“expo.android.package”中添加了包名
--并从中获取了sha-1证书指纹https://expo.dev/accounts/{username}/projects/{project}/credentials
经典android凭据:构建凭据:sha-1证书指纹。
我已经能够用同样的方式限制androidMapsdk和地理编码api。
我还没有将该应用程序添加到google play。
我还没有找到解决办法,通过测试和谷歌搜索,如果有这种情况的指示。
谢谢你的帮助!

暂无答案!

目前还没有任何答案,快来回答吧!

相关问题